<p class="text-gray-700">Schulze has nice moves in the pivot. He uses dropsteps upon sealing for position. Josh works angles well, kissing shots off the glass. Against Jonesboro, he turned over his right shoulder to score with a left-handed hook. The 6-foot-7 forward collected 6 points, 7 rebounds and 2 assists. He has developed nicely upon his arrival at Woodstock. Schulze would be a very good get at the D-III level.</p>

<p class="text-gray-700">It has been a good offseason for Jason Hill. His game is starting to expand. Jason has been his typical rough and tumble self in the paint, but his aggressiveness has expanded out to 15-feet, capable of attacking the basket. Hill uses backdowns in the post, getting to up-and-under finishes. He rips the ball away from the opposition upon securing rebounds. Jason tallied 6 points, 9 rebounds, 2 assists and 1 block in a win over North Cobb Christian.</p>

<p class="text-gray-700">Tyler came off the bench against Spalding to give Bowdon a spark, netting 9 points, 2 rebounds and 1 assist. The lefty finished around the rim. He scored on a turnaround jumper out of the post and sunk a corner three. Wyatt has nice physical size and interesting touch. If he can be consistent, the senior could see his stock rise in Year 4.</p>

<p class="text-gray-700">I like how the physical post plays. A broken nose didn't stop Styles from competing. Reece flashed up-and-under moves inside and passed well out of the post. Styles is a good screener. His toughness in the paint is an underrated aspect of East Forsyth's success. He had 6 points, 7 rebounds and 2 assists against Osborne.</p>

<p class="text-gray-700">The space eating lefty was very effective against Marietta. Reeves did a nice job getting in position to catch and finish on dump offs. His wide shoulders make it tough for taller players to block his shot. TK did well rebounding in traffic. He had 7 points and 5 rebounds.</p>
